Types of Burn Severity

As burn injury lawyers serving Yonkers families for over four decades, we've seen how different types of burns can impact lives in vastly different ways. Let us help you understand the severity of your injury and what it means for your legal claim.

  • First-degree burns: These affect only the outer skin layer, causing redness and pain. While they typically heal within days, if someone's negligence caused your injury, you may still deserve compensation for your suffering.
  • Second-degree burns: Going deeper into the skin, these burns cause intense pain and blistering. Recovery often takes weeks or months, requiring ongoing medical care and leaving potential scars.
  • Third-degree burns: These severe burns destroy all skin layers and reach underlying tissues. Due to nerve damage, they sometimes feel less painful, but they require extensive medical treatment, including skin grafts and long-term rehabilitation.
  • Fourth-degree burns: The most severe type, reaching muscles and bone. These life-threatening injuries need immediate emergency care and often result in permanent changes to your life.

Seek Immediate Medical Care

First and foremost, seek immediate medical attention — even if the burn seems minor. Burns can be deceptive, with damage continuing to develop hours after the initial injury. Some of our clients initially thought their burns weren't serious enough to seek medical care, only to discover later that the injury was much more severe than it appeared. Don't try to tough it out; let medical professionals assess your injury immediately.

Document Everything You Can

While your health is the top priority, document everything you can about the incident. Take photos of your injuries and the scene where the burn occurred. Save any items that might have contributed to the burn, like faulty equipment or products. If there were witnesses, ask for their contact information. Even small details can make a significant difference in your case later.

Keep a Recovery Journal

Save all medical records and receipts, and document how the injury affects your daily life. Write down your memories of the incident as soon as you can — trauma can make memories fade quickly. If you cannot do this yourself, ask a family member to help.

Time Limits for Filing Your Burn Injury Claim in Yonkers

Understanding the legal deadlines for your burn injury claim is crucial. Here are the specific timeframes you need to know:

  • Standard personal injury claims: For most burn injury cases in Yonkers, you have three years from the date of the accident to file your lawsuit. While this might seem like plenty of time, building a strong case requires immediate investigation and securing evidence.
  • Claims against government entities: If your burn injury involved a government entity — such as a public building or municipal worker — you must file a Notice of Claim within 90 days of the incident. After filing this notice, you have one year and 90 days to file your lawsuit.
  • Medical malpractice: If your burn injury resulted from medical treatment, such as radiation therapy or the use of lasers, you generally have 2.5 years (30 months) from the date of injury to file your claim.
  • Wrongful death: In tragic cases where a burn injury results in death, the family has two years from the date of death to file a wrongful death lawsuit.

Some situations may affect your filing deadline:

  • Injuries to minors: When a child suffers a burn injury, the three-year statute of limitations doesn't begin to run until their 18th birthday.
  • Discovery rule: In some cases where the injury or its cause wasn't immediately apparent, the time limit may begin from when you discovered (or reasonably should have discovered) the injury.
